Community Foundation of Des Moines County grew to record levels in 2024 with its two largest funds growing to more than $1 million each. The Community Foundation of Des Moines County is proud to announce its assets have grown to over $5.22 Million as of Dec. 31, 2024.


Milestones of this growth are:

  • Asset growth from 2023 was $1,708,394 or 48.6% after fees and grants

  • Five new funds totaling over $993,968. with two new family funds of $400,000

  • Total contributions of $1,389,096 including the five new funds

  • 1st Family Fund founded in 2011 grows to over in $1 million in 14 years

  • Margaret Hansen Community Impact Fund founded in 2006 grows to second-largest fund with over $1 million in assets


The foundation has grown tremendously since its inception in 2006 to the time it gave out more than $137,000 in grants in 2024 to community nonprofits.


The Community Foundation of Des Moines County has been created by and for the people of Des Moines County. The Community Foundation's main goals are to support charitable projects and programs in Des Moines County (giving out $959,613.37 in grants since 2009) and to attract additional funds to assist donors in creating lasting legacies through a variety of giving options.
